A knock sounded on the door to Aurora's room. It was timid and certainly not anyone Aurora was familiar with. Demetri and Felix would've barged in without a care. With a frown the girl got up from her bed to open the door.
Upon opening the door she found the newest receptionist, Giana, nervously standing there, two envelopes on a plate.
"Hello, Giana. What can I do for you?" Aurora asked, tilting her head.
"W-well a l-l-letter came for you M-miss." The receptionist stuttered, eyes looking anywhere but at Aurora.
"Well thank you, Giana." Aurora stated with a smile, picking up the envelope. "Of that one is for Aro, Caius and Marcus, I recommend waiting giving it to them."
Of course, Giana wouldn't listen, but it was worth a shot. "Yes m'am."
Aurora smiled sweetly before shutting the door and flipping the letter over in her hands before sitting on her bed.
Aurora couldn't stop the squeal that came out of her mouth, "Finally!"
"What are you squealing about, Rory?" Jane asked, coming in with her hands over her ears, a concerned look plastered on her face.
"They are getting m-a-r-r-i-e-d!" Aurora said in a singsong voice, clapping her hands together in excitement.
"Who?" Jane asked, eyebrows furrowed, "Demetri and Felix?"
Aurora giggled, shaking her head slightly, "No, Bella and Edward! I've been waiting for this for awhile."
"You...you aren't thinking about going are you?" Jane asked, her eyebrow raising in question.
"Well, yeah." Aurora slumped.
Jane shook her head frantically and took Auroras hands in her own.
"You can't! Don't." Jane urged, squeezing Aurora's hands. "If you can't control your thirst, which I don't think you can, it could be disastrous. Aro would probably-" Jane cut off suddenly, her voice unsteady.
Advertisement
"What?" Aurora asked, putting a hand on Jane's shoulder comfortingly. "What would Aro do?"
Jane gulped, not meeting her mate's eyes. "Aro might kill you."
Aurora pursed her lips, "Well that doesn't sound good." She said bluntly. "I'm going to go anyway." She shrugged her shoulders nonchalantly and skipped past Jane out of the room.
"What? Aurora!" Jane called, rushing out after her.
Aurora giggled as she ran away, before running into something hard. Stumbling back she found Demetri and Felix, covered in blood, looking down at her with amused expressions.
"Going somewhere?" Demetri smirked.
"Running from Jane." Demetri and Felix's eyes widened in fear at her name.
"Good luck." Demetri laughed, glancing around for the girl.
"What's with the blood?" Aurora asked, the smell super appealing to her.
Demetri and Felix shared a nervous look, "We need a new receptionist."
Aurora rolled her eyes, "I told her to wait, but does anyone ever listen? No."
She went to push past the boys but was stopped by Felix. "By the way, Aro wishes to speak with you, something about a wedding."
